New York: Sully & Kleinteich. Very Good. Hard Cover. Not dated (c. 1900-1910). Gray boards with title labels to front and spine. Tight binding, clean pages. A touch of very light shelf wear with slight rubbing to darkened spine, and previous owner's initials neatly inked to top of front endpaper, otherwise an excellent copy. ; 16mo; 184 pages .
